获取jtextfield内的内容
时间: 2023-09-04 09:12:50 浏览: 111
你可以使用JTextField的getText()方法来获取JTextField控件中的文本内容。例如:
```
JTextField textField = new JTextField();
String content = textField.getText();
```
这样,`content`变量中就存储了`textField`控件中的文本内容。
相关问题
获取JTextField内的内容
你可以使用JTextField的getText()方法来获取JTextField控件中的文本内容。例如:
```
JTextField textField = new JTextField();
String content = textField.getText();
```
这样,`content`变量中就存储了`textField`控件中的文本内容。
jtextfield获取从数据库内容
要从数据库中获取内容并在JTextField中显示,您需要完成以下步骤:
1. 连接到数据库并执行查询语句,将结果存储在变量中。
2. 使用JTextField的setText()方法将查询结果设置为文本框的文本。
以下是一个示例代码片段,可以帮助您完成此操作:
```
try {
// 连接到数据库
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ost/mydatabase", "username", "password");
// 执行查询语句
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ery("SELECT content FROM mytable WHERE id = 1");
// 获取查询结果
String content = "";
if (rs.next()) {
content = rs.getString("content");
}
// 将结果设置为文本框的文本
JTextField textField = new JTextField();
textField.setText(content);
// 关闭连接
rs.close();
stmt.close();
con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
```
请注意,此示例仅获取一个值并将其设置为单个文本框的文本。如果您需要从多个行或列中获取值,则需要修改代码以适应您的需求。